About MRBK Meridian Corporation

Meridian Corp is a bank holding company. Through its banking subsidiary, it operates as a full-service, state-chartered commercial bank providing personal, business lending, and deposit services. It operates in three reportable segments including Bank, Wealth, and Mortgage. The company generates maximum revenue from the Bank segment which consists of commercial and retail banking. It generates interest income from its lending (including leasing) and investing activities and is dependent on the gathering of lower-cost deposits from its branch network or borrowed funds from other sources for funding its loans.

About MRCC Monroe Capital Corporation

Monroe Capital Corp is a speciality finance company focused on providing financing to lower middle-market companies, in the U.S. and Canada. The company provides customized financing solutions focused on senior, unitranche, and junior secured debt and unsecured subordinated debt and equity, including equity co-investments in preferred and common stock and warrants.
